1. 主页 > AI技术 > AI软件技术

数字人的表情是如何与文字内容进行匹配的?

目前,虚拟数字人的应用日渐广泛,我们看到数字人的表情与数字人说话的文本内容非常匹配,毫无违和感,这使得数字人非常逼真,那么,技术上是如何做到数字人表情和文本内容的匹配的呢

AI数字人生成.jpg

数字人的表情匹配文字内容是通过自然语言处理(NLP)和计算机视觉技术实现的。这种技术可以让数字人根据输入的文字内容自动生成相应的表情,从而更好地与用户进行互动。

以下是数字人表情匹配文字内容的实现过程:

1. 文本预处理

首先,对输入的文字内容进行预处理,包括分词、去除停用词、词干提取等操作。这些操作可以帮助我们更好地理解文本的含义,为后续的表情匹配提供基础。

2. 情感分析

接下来,对预处理后的文本进行情感分析,判断文本所表达的情感倾向。情感分析可以通过训练好的机器学习模型或者深度学习模型来实现。例如,可以使用卷积神经网络(CNN)或者循环神经网络(RNN)来捕捉文本中的语义信息,从而判断其情感倾向。

3. 表情库构建

为了实现数字人的表情匹配,需要构建一个包含多种表情的图片库。这些图片可以是预先设计好的,也可以是通过数据增强技术从现有的图片中生成的。表情库应该包含各种情感的表情,如高兴、悲伤、惊讶、愤怒等。

4. 表情匹配算法

根据情感分析的结果,从表情库中选择与文本情感相符的表情。表情匹配算法可以是基于规则的方法,也可以是基于机器学习或深度学习的方法。基于规则的方法可以根据情感类别直接选择对应的表情;而基于机器学习或深度学习的方法则需要训练一个模型,输入是文本情感,输出是表情图片。

5. 表情合成

将选定的表情图片与数字人的脸部特征进行融合,生成最终的数字人表情。这一步通常需要使用到计算机视觉技术,如图像分割、特征提取等。通过这些技术,可以将表情图片无缝地融入到数字人的脸部特征中,从而实现数字人的表情变化。

6. 实时交互

最后,将生成的数字人表情应用到实时交互场景中,如聊天机器人、虚拟助手等。这样,数字人就可以根据用户的文字内容自动生成相应的表情,提高用户体验。

概括来讲,数字人的表情匹配文字内容是通过自然语言处理和计算机视觉技术实现的。通过对输入的文字内容进行情感分析,从表情库中选择相应的表情图片,并将其与数字人的脸部特征进行融合,从而实现数字人的表情变化。这种技术在聊天机器人、虚拟助手等领域具有广泛的应用前景。

AI面捕技术:实时捕捉和分析人脸表情

AI系统控制虚拟数字人的面部表情

数字人面部微表情采集是如何进行的?

数字人微表情怎么抓取和合成?

AI语音如何驱动虚拟数字人微表情?

本文由小熊AI网发布,不代表小熊AI网立场,转载联系作者并注明出处:https://www.xiaoxiong360.com/html/software/2085.html